Types of Sections in a Psychometric Test
What Is a Psychometric Test and Why Should Students Take One?
A psychometric test is a combination of different sets of questions designed to assess a student’s abilities, interests, personality, and emotional intelligence. Many students mistakenly believe that an aptitude test or an emotional intelligence test alone qualifies as a psychometric test. However, the truth is that a psychometric test is a well-rounded assessment comprising four key sections:
- Aptitude Test
- Interest Inventory
- Personality Assessment
- Emotional Intelligence
Each of these sections is explained in detail below:
1. Aptitude Test
This section evaluates verbal reasoning, logical thinking, problem-solving ability, numerical skills, and abstract reasoning. It measures how effectively students can process information, recognise patterns, and apply their knowledge in new situations. The results help students identify their potential, academic strengths, and suitable career paths.
2. Interest Inventory
This part focuses on identifying what truly excites and motivates a student. It includes various scenarios, tasks, and career-related options. Based on the student’s responses, the results align their interests with relevant creative or professional paths. This insight helps reduce burnout and regret from choosing an unsuitable career.
3. Personality Assessment
As the name suggests, this section evaluates a student’s personality traits, emotional tendencies, and behavioural patterns. It explores how they interact with others and respond to their environment. The outcome categorises personality types—such as introvert or extrovert—and suggests career roles best suited to those characteristics.
4. Emotional Intelligence (EQ)
Emotions are a critical part of personality and behaviour. Being overly emotional or emotionally detached can both be problematic. This section assesses how well an individual can understand, express, and regulate emotions, as well as how they perceive and respond to others’ emotions. The test indicates whether a person is empathetic and emotionally aware—qualities essential for personal and professional success.

The Importance of Psychometric Testing for Students
The foundation of a successful career begins with early planning. The sooner you understand your strengths and aspirations, the better your decisions will be. While Career Counselling is essential, skipping a psychometric test can mean missing out on vital self-awareness. Regardless of your age or academic level, here’s how a psychometric test can benefit you:
Classes 8–9: Skill Discovery and Development
Discovering your potential career path early allows you to prepare effectively. Not knowing what you want to do—even after graduation—can feel like a real-life horror story. Taking a psychometric test in Grade 8 or 9 gives you the freedom to explore options while your interests are still forming. It helps you identify which skills you need to develop and where you might excel. Career counselling alongside this process ensures you make the most of the insights gained.
Class 10: Stream Selection
One of the biggest challenges after Grade 10 is choosing the right academic stream. Many students, unaware of psychometric tests or career guidance, choose a stream based on peer pressure or parental expectations. Taking a psychometric test helps you make an informed decision that aligns with your future career goals. You’ll gain clarity on which subjects and courses will support your aspirations, and guidance at this stage is invaluable.
Classes 11–12: Entrance Exam Preparation
The Indian education system is highly competitive, with entrance exams such as NEET, JEE, and UPSC shaping many students’ futures. Yet, it’s entirely possible that your ideal career doesn’t require any of these exams. Taking a psychometric test in Grade 11 or 12 helps you gain clarity about your path, identify your strengths, and understand which areas need improvement. With personalised guidance, you can plan your entrance exam strategy—or decide whether one is needed at all.
After Class 12: Career Clarity
“What should I do after Class 12?” is a question that haunts many students. If you are uncertain about your post-graduation plans, a psychometric test can offer clarity. Based on your results, along with expert guidance, you’ll know whether you should switch courses, study abroad, take a gap year, or enter the workforce. It gives you a concrete action plan to move forward with confidence.
